.post-10 .et_pb_section:nth-child(3)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-10 .et_pb_section:nth-child(4)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-1876 .et_pb_section:nth-child(3)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-2404 .et_pb_section:nth-child(1) {
       padding-bottom: 0px!important; 
       padding-top: 0px!important; 
    } 

.post-2404 .et_pb_section:nth-child(2) .et_pb_row:nth-child(1) {
       padding-top: 0px!important; 
    } 

.post-2404 .et_pb_section:nth-child(2) .et_pb_row:nth-child(2) {
       padding-bottom: 0px!important; 
       padding-top: 0px!important; 
    } 

.post-2404 .et_pb_section:nth-child(2) {
       padding-bottom: 0px!important; 
       padding-top: 0px!important; 
    } 

.post-2404 .et_pb_section:nth-child(3) .et_pb_row:nth-child(1) {
       padding-bottom: 0px!important; 
    } 

.post-2404 .et_pb_section:nth-child(3) {
       padding-bottom: 0px!important; 
       padding-top: 0px!important; 
    } 

.post-2404 .et_pb_section:nth-child(4) {
       padding-bottom: 0px!important; 
       padding-top: 0px!important; 
    } 

.post-2404 .et_pb_section:nth-child(5)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-2404 .et_pb_section:nth-child(8)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-2408 .et_pb_section:nth-child(4)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-2411 .et_pb_section:nth-child(4)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-2970 .et_pb_section: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 22px; 
    } 

.post-2970 .et_pb_section:nth-child(3)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-2970 .et_pb_section:nth-child(4)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-3255 .et_pb_section:nth-child(10)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-3255 .et_pb_section:nth-child(10) .et_pb_team_member .et_pb_member_position {
       text-align: center!important; 
    } 

.post-3255 .et_pb_section:nth-child(10) .et_pb_team_member .et_pb_team_member_description > h4 {
       text-align: center!important; 
    } 

.post-3255 .et_pb_section:nth-child(11) .et_pb_row:nth-child(1) .et_pb_column:nth-child(2) {
       background-repeat: repeat!important; 
       height: 383px; 
    } 

.post-3255 .et_pb_section:nth-child(11)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-3255 .et_pb_section:nth-child(11)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-3255 .et_pb_section:nth-child(2) {
       padding-bottom: 0px!important; 
       padding-top: 11px!important; 
    } 

.post-3255 .et_pb_section:nth-child(3) .et_pb_row:nth-child(1) {
       padding-top: 0px!important; 
    } 

.post-3255 .et_pb_section:nth-child(3) {
       padding-bottom: 31px!important; 
    } 

.post-3255 .et_pb_section:nth-child(4) .et_pb_slider .et_pb_slide_content  {
       color: transparent!important; 
    } 

.post-3255 .et_pb_section:nth-child(5) .et_pb_row:nth-child(1) .et_pb_column:nth-child(1) {
       height: auto; 
       text-align: center!important; 
    } 

.post-3255 .et_pb_section:nth-child(5) .et_pb_row:nth-child(1) {
       padding-bottom: 0px!important; 
       padding-top: 19px!important; 
    } 

.post-3255 .et_pb_section:nth-child(5) {
       padding-bottom: 0px!important; 
       padding-top: 0px!important; 
    } 

.post-3255 .et_pb_section:nth-child(6) .et_pb_image {
       background-position: left bottom!important; 
       background-size: 100% 100%; 
       height: 508px; 
       padding-bottom: 0px!important; 
       padding-top: 37px; 
       position: relative; 
    } 

.post-3255 .et_pb_section:nth-child(6) .et_pb_image img {
       background-blend-mode: normal; 
       background-position: left bottom; 
       background-size: 100% 100%; 
       float: left; 
       opacity: 1; 
       position: static; 
       top: auto; 
       z-index: -1!important; 
    } 

.post-3255 .et_pb_section:nth-child(6) .et_pb_number_counter p {
       padding-bottom: 0px!important; 
       text-align: left; 
    } 

.post-3255 .et_pb_section:nth-child(6) .et_pb_number_counter p span {
       font-size: 79px!important; 
       padding-bottom: 0px!important; 
    } 

.post-3255 .et_pb_section:nth-child(6) .et_pb_promo .et_pb_promo_button {
       position: relative!important; 
       top: -50px; 
    } 

.post-3255 .et_pb_section:nth-child(6) .et_pb_promo .et_pb_promo_description  {
       padding-bottom: 0px; 
    } 

.post-3255 .et_pb_section:nth-child(6) .et_pb_row:nth-child(1) .et_pb_column: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 15px; 
    } 

.post-3255 .et_pb_section:nth-child(6) .et_pb_slider .et_pb_slide_content  {
       color: transparent!important; 
       line-height: 25px!important; 
       padding-top: 40px!important; 
       text-shadow: none!important; 
    } 

.post-3255 .et_pb_section:nth-child(6) .et_pb_text   h2 {
       line-height: 0px; 
       padding-bottom: 0px; 
    } 

.post-3255 .et_pb_section:nth-child(6) .et_pb_text   h4 {
       font-size: 38px!important; 
       line-height: 16px!important; 
    } 

.post-3255 .et_pb_section:nth-child(6) .et_pb_text   p {
       padding-bottom: 32px!important; 
    } 

.post-3255 .et_pb_section:nth-child(6)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-3255 .et_pb_section:nth-child(8) .et_pb_row:nth-child(1) {
       padding-bottom: 0px!important; 
       padding-top: 0px!important; 
    } 

.post-3326 .et_pb_section:nth-child(10)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-3326 .et_pb_section:nth-child(9)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-3536 .et_pb_section:nth-child(4)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-3623 .et_pb_section:nth-child(3)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-3623 .et_pb_section:nth-child(4)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-37 .et_pb_section:nth-child(4)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-37 .et_pb_section:nth-child(4) .et_pb_row:nth-child(2)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-37 .et_pb_section:nth-child(4) .et_pb_row:nth-child(3)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-37 .et_pb_section:nth-child(4) .et_pb_row:nth-child(4)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-37 .et_pb_section:nth-child(4) {
       padding-bottom: 25px; 
       padding-top: 25px; 
    } 

.post-37 .et_pb_section:nth-child(6)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-39 .et_pb_section:nth-child(3)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-39 .et_pb_section:nth-child(4)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-3924 .et_pb_section:nth-child(4)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-41 .et_pb_section:nth-child(2)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-41 .et_pb_section:nth-child(4)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

.post-4865 .et_pb_section:nth-child(1) {
       height: 1652px; 
       padding-bottom: 65px; 
       padding-top: 58px; 
    } 

.post-4865 .et_pb_section:nth-child(3) .et_pb_row:nth-child(1) {
       padding-bottom: 0px; 
       padding-top: 0px; 
    } 

 #rev_slider_2_1_wrapper  {
       height: auto!important; 
    } 

html body div#et-top-navigation ul.nav .sub-menu {
       width: 250px; 
    } 

html body div#et-top-navigation ul.nav li ul li a {
       line-height: 20px; 
       padding-right: 0px!important; 
       width: 225px; 
    } 

html body div#footer-bottom {
    } 

.post-3255 .et_pb_section:nth-child(10) {
    } 

.post-3255 .et_pb_section:nth-child(10) .et_pb_row:nth-child(1) .et_pb_column:nth-child(1) {
    } 

.post-3255 .et_pb_section:nth-child(11) .et_pb_row:nth-child(1) .et_pb_column:nth-child(1) {
    } 

.post-3255 .et_pb_section:nth-child(5) .et_pb_blurb .et_pb_blurb_content .et_pb_main_blurb_image img {
    } 

.post-3255 .et_pb_section:nth-child(8) .et_pb_row:nth-child(1) .et_pb_column:nth-child(1) {
    } 


@media screen and (max-width: 1024px)  { .post-3255 .et_pb_section:nth-child(5) .et_pb_row:nth-child(1) .et_pb_column:nth-child(1) {   height: auto; }  }  
@media screen and (max-width: 1024px)  { .post-3255 .et_pb_section:nth-child(6) .et_pb_number_counter p {   font-size: 58px; }  }  
@media screen and (max-width: 1024px)  { .post-3255 .et_pb_section:nth-child(6) .et_pb_number_counter p span {   font-size: 59px!important; }  }  
@media screen and (max-width: 1024px)  { .post-3255 .et_pb_section:nth-child(6) .et_pb_row:nth-child(1) .et_pb_column:nth-child(1) {   padding-top: 0px; }  }  
@media screen and (max-width: 1024px)  { .post-3255 .et_pb_section:nth-child(6) .et_pb_text   h2 {   padding-top: 18px; }  }  
@media screen and (max-width: 1024px)  { .post-3255 .et_pb_section:nth-child(6) .et_pb_text   h4 {   font-size: 30px!important; }  }  
@media screen and (max-width: 1024px)  { .post-3255 .et_pb_section:nth-child(6) .et_pb_text   p {   line-height: 21px; }  }  
@media screen and (max-width: 768px)  { .post-3255 .et_pb_section:nth-child(11) .et_pb_row:nth-child(1) .et_pb_column:nth-child(2) {   height: 543px; }  }  
@media screen and (max-width: 768px)  { .post-3255 .et_pb_section:nth-child(5) .et_pb_row:nth-child(1) .et_pb_column:nth-child(1) {   height: auto; }  }  
@media screen and (max-width: 768px)  { html body div#footer-bottom {   height: 238px; }  }  
@media screen and (max-width: 768px)  { html body div#footer-bottom {   padding-top: 3px; }  }  
@media screen and (max-width: 667px)  { .post-3255 .et_pb_section:nth-child(10) {   padding-bottom: 0px!important; }  }  
@media screen and (max-width: 667px)  { .post-3255 .et_pb_section:nth-child(10) {   padding-top: 0px!important; }  }  
@media screen and (max-width: 480px)  { .post-3255 .et_pb_section:nth-child(10) .et_pb_row:nth-child(1) .et_pb_column:nth-child(1) {   padding-left: 61px!important; }  }  
@media screen and (max-width: 480px)  { .post-3255 .et_pb_section:nth-child(10) {   padding-bottom: 0px!important; }  }  
@media screen and (max-width: 480px)  { .post-3255 .et_pb_section:nth-child(10) {   padding-top: 0px!important; }  }  
@media screen and (max-width: 480px)  { .post-3255 .et_pb_section:nth-child(11) .et_pb_row:nth-child(1) .et_pb_column:nth-child(1) {   padding-left: 38px; }  }  
@media screen and (max-width: 480px)  { .post-3255 .et_pb_section:nth-child(5) .et_pb_blurb .et_pb_blurb_content .et_pb_main_blurb_image img {   line-height: 0px!important; }  }  
@media screen and (max-width: 480px)  { .post-3255 .et_pb_section:nth-child(5) .et_pb_row:nth-child(1) .et_pb_column:nth-child(1) {   line-height: -50px!important; }  }  
@media screen and (max-width: 480px)  { .post-3255 .et_pb_section:nth-child(5) .et_pb_row:nth-child(1) .et_pb_column:nth-child(1) {   padding-left: 42px!important; }  }  
@media screen and (max-width: 480px)  { .post-3255 .et_pb_section:nth-child(5) {   line-height: 0px!important; }  }  
@media screen and (max-width: 480px)  { .post-3255 .et_pb_section:nth-child(6) .et_pb_image {   height: 246px; }  }  
@media screen and (max-width: 480px)  { .post-3255 .et_pb_section:nth-child(6) .et_pb_promo .et_pb_promo_button {   font-size: 19px!important; }  }  
@media screen and (max-width: 480px)  { .post-3255 .et_pb_section:nth-child(6) {   height: 285px; }  }  
@media screen and (max-width: 480px)  { .post-3255 .et_pb_section:nth-child(8) .et_pb_row:nth-child(1) .et_pb_column:nth-child(1) {   padding-left: 0px!important; }  }  
@media screen and (max-width: 480px)  { .post-3255 .et_pb_section:nth-child(8) .et_pb_row:nth-child(1) .et_pb_column:nth-child(1) {   padding-right: 21px!important; }  }  
@media screen and (max-width: 480px)  { .post-3255 .et_pb_section:nth-child(8) .et_pb_row:nth-child(1) .et_pb_column:nth-child(1) {   padding-top: 69px!important; }  }  
@media screen and (max-width: 480px)  { .post-3255 .et_pb_section:nth-child(8) .et_pb_row:nth-child(1) .et_pb_column:nth-child(1) {   text-align: center!important; }  }  
@media screen and (max-width: 480px)  {  #rev_slider_2_1_wrapper  {   height: auto!important; }  }  